instance method reconfigure_connection_timezone

Ruby on Rails 7.2.3

Since v7.1.6 Private

Available in: v7.1.6 v7.2.3 v8.0.4 v8.1.2

Signature

reconfigure_connection_timezone()

No documentation comment.

Source
# File activerecord/lib/active_record/connection_adapters/postgresql_adapter.rb, line 1047
        def reconfigure_connection_timezone
          variables = @config.fetch(:variables, {}).stringify_keys

          # If it's been directly configured as a connection variable, we don't
          # need to do anything here; it will be set up by configure_connection
          # and then never changed.
          return if variables["timezone"]

          # If using Active Record's time zone support configure the connection
          # to return TIMESTAMP WITH ZONE types in UTC.
          if default_timezone == :utc
            internal_execute("SET SESSION timezone TO 'UTC'")
          else
            internal_execute("SET SESSION timezone TO DEFAULT")
          end
        end
